Getting Started

In the following, we assume that your system administrator has provided you with a working installation of Vistle. If you need to install Vistle, please consult GitHub.

Starting Vistle

On UNIX (Linux and macOS) and Windows, you should be able to start Vistle by typing vistle into a terminal window. If you want to open an existing workflow, you can do so by appending the workflow description (stored in a file with the extension .vsl) file on the command line. You can see a short description of supported command line arguments by invoking vistle -h.

Just typing vistle will also start its graphical user interface where you can configure workflows.
